It is a problem in all decentralized systems. Once you publish something, there is no going back. Anyone of your peers can decide to leave with your sensitive data. That's also what make them so resistant to data loss.

Now if you know everyone who has a copy of your repository, you can have them run a bunch of sqlite commands / low level git commands to make sure that the commit is gone.

If you didn't publish anything, as someone else said, your best bet is to make an entirely new clone, transfer the work you did on the original, omitting the sensitive data, then nuke the original.

The difference seems to be that commits are serious business on fossil, and they encourage you to test before you commit. While on git, commits are more trivial, pushing is where things become serious.

> your best bet is to make an entirely new clone

Or you can just rebase to edit the commits and remove the secret file. If you're really paranoid you can run `git gc` vto ensure the object file is cleaned up also. If you're super paranoid, then you can do:

git hash-object secretpassword.txt

And check that hash isn't an object in the `.git/objects` directory.
